Coral, Turquoise and Woolly Mammoth Ivory BraceletI love the combination of colors on this bracelet. Contrasting, but somehow easing to the eye. The history of these lovely beads are quite remarkable. Starting with the turquoise, this piece is from Tibet and was worn 100's of years ago for ceremony. The white beads are Hawaiian puka shells I found on Kauai. The tan colored bead is a genuine piece of woolly mammoth ivory from a melting glacier in Alaska.
